WebbNever start the centrifuge when the centrifuge door is open. Do not move the centrifuge while it is running. Do not lean on the centrifuge. Do not place anything on top of the centrifuge during a run. Never open the centrifuge door until the rotor has come to a complete stop and this has been confirmed in the display. The micro centrifuge is a small benchtop centrifuge, for spinning small-volume samples at high speed. Typical sample size: 0.2 - 2ml volume. Typical speed: 13,000 - 15,000 rpm. Typical G-force: 16,000 - 20,000 x g.
